Taxonomy & naming
Homatula disparizona was described in 2013 by Min, Yang and Chen as the first member of the genus Homatula recorded from the Red River drainage of China, based on specimens from the Panlong River near Xichou County, Wenshan City, Yunnan. It belongs to the family Nemacheilidae, the stone or brook loaches, the largest and most species-rich family within the loach superfamily Cobitoidea.
The species has also circulated under the name Schistura disparizona; Nemacheilidae taxonomy has been revised repeatedly as the old broad genera Nemacheilus and Noemacheilus were split apart, with many species redistributed among Schistura, Homatula, Triplophysa, Barbatula and other genera. The Catalog of Fishes is the authority for the currently valid combination, which places this species in Homatula; that placement is retained here rather than reverting to the older Schistura usage some sources still carry.
Morphology
This is a small loach: the holotype measured 3 in standard length, and FishBase lists a maximum length around 3 in SL, putting it at the modest end of the stone-loach size range. The original description notes a scaleless body, a variable color pattern that runs from a barred pattern anteriorly — with the bars joined along the back — to a striped pattern posteriorly, marked with pale, ovoid blotches along the midlateral line. The caudal fin is emarginate (shallowly forked), the dorsal fin carries 7.5–8.5 branched rays, the lips are thin and smooth, the lower jaw lacks a median notch, and the axillary pelvic lobe is absent or only rudimentary.
As in other nemacheilids, the skin is essentially naked — the scales, where present, are tiny and deeply embedded rather than forming an obvious armor — which matters for how the fish should be handled and medicated. Diagnostic detail beyond the original description is sparse; this species has not been the subject of further published morphological work that we can point to.
Habitat
Homatula disparizona is known from the Red River (Yuan Jiang/Song Hong) drainage in Yunnan, China, specifically streams in the Panlong River system near Xichou County. FishBase describes the habitat as clear-water streams with slow current over a rocky bottom, classifying the species as a tropical freshwater demersal fish.
This places it in the general habitat pattern of stone loaches — clean, well-oxygenated running water over stone and gravel — though the specific current speed recorded (slow rather than fast/torrential) sets it apart from the swiftest hillstream specialists. As a range-restricted stream endemic described only in 2013, its documented distribution is narrow, and data on seasonal habitat use, population size, or additional watersheds is not available in the sources we could verify.
Feeding
FishBase records a low trophic level for this species (around 2.8), consistent with a bottom-feeding micro-predator taking small invertebrates rather than other fish. This matches the general diet pattern seen across Nemacheilidae: insect larvae, small crustaceans, worms and other invertebrates picked from the streambed, with closely related Homatula and Schistura species also reported as omnivorous, taking some plant material and detritus.
No aquarium feeding record exists for Homatula disparizona specifically, since the species has no established presence in the trade. Based on its close relatives and its stream micro-predator ecology, it would be expected to take sinking live and frozen foods (bloodworm, Artemia, Daphnia) readily and dried foods less readily — but this is inference from the wider genus rather than a documented fact for this species.
Mating
No courtship or spawning behavior has been documented for Homatula disparizona. The original 2013 description is a taxonomic paper focused on morphology and does not report reproductive biology, and no aquarium spawning record exists to draw on. As with the great majority of stone and brook loaches, this species has essentially no history in the hobby, so there is no observational basis for describing pairing behavior, sexual dimorphism in the field, or spawning triggers.
Breeding
There is no known breeding record for this species, in the wild or in captivity. Based on the general pattern for Nemacheilidae, stone and brook loaches are egg-scatterers that release eggs over gravel or among stones in flowing water with no parental care, and the great majority of the family — including small, range-restricted, recently described species like this one — has never been bred in a home aquarium. That is the honest expectation for Homatula disparizona: an egg-scattering species with no parental care, essentially unknown in captive spawning, and with the data simply too sparse to say more.
In the aquarium
Homatula disparizona has no established presence in the aquarium trade, and no keeping reports for this species specifically could be verified. What can be said comes from its taxonomy and habitat: it is a small (under 3 in), scaleless stone loach from clear, cool-to-mild streams over rock, and general nemacheilid care principles would apply if it were ever kept — a well-oxygenated tank with a rocky, gravel substrate, moderate flow, and stable, clean water, plus caution with medications given its naked skin and consequent sensitivity to copper-based treatments and full-strength doses.
Because none of this is confirmed for the species itself, prospective keepers should treat any specimen encountered as effectively undocumented in captivity, and default to the conservative, well-oxygenated, rock-and-gravel stream setup used successfully for its better-known Homatula and Schistura relatives.
Conservation
Homatula disparizona has not been assessed on the IUCN Red List and carries no conservation category; we record it as Not Evaluated rather than guess at a status. Its documented range is narrow — the Panlong River system in the Red River drainage of Yunnan, China — which is typical of the many recently described nemacheilid species that are known from only one or a few streams.
As a range-restricted stream endemic with no recorded aquarium trade, the species' conservation picture is essentially undocumented rather than reassuring: a small distribution paired with no population trend data is a common situation across Nemacheilidae, and formal assessment would be needed before any status beyond Not Evaluated could be assigned.
